Success can mean whatever you want it to mean. Love. Money. A nice place to live. A business that fulfils you. A family. Good health. A supportive community.

 

Whatever “success” you desire, you’re probably very focused on the practical actions you need to be taking. We’ve been taught to focus on DOING that we can easily forget about how we are BEING.

 

These steps that Swami shared are not steps that you do, but steps that you embody. How you show up in the world energetically and how you interact with others. 

 

Here’s what Swami shared:

 

1. Be happy when you see others succeed

When you can genuinely cheer for others, you’re tapping into abundance and inviting more positivity into your own life. In contrast, jealousy sends the message to the universe that you don’t want what the other person has.

 

2. Learn to love what you do & where life has put you now ❤️‍🔥

Success arises from gratitude. Even if your current situation isn’t what you want it to be, embracing it can open doors to growth and new opportunities. It always has something to teach you.

 

3. Help others to become successful 🫂

When you uplift others, you create a ripple effect of abundance and fulfillment. The positive energy you share is always reflected back to you, and success grows when it’s shared.
